NBD: add partition support
Permit the use of partitions with network block devices (NBD).
A new parameter is introduced to define how many partition we want to be able
to manage per network block device. This parameter is "max_part".
For instance, to manage 63 partitions / loop device, we will do:
[on the server side]
# nbd-server 1234 /dev/sdb
[on the client side]
# modprobe nbd max_part=63
# ls -l /dev/nbd*
brw-rw---- 1 root disk 43, 0 2008-03-25 11:14 /dev/nbd0
brw-rw---- 1 root disk 43, 64 2008-03-25 11:11 /dev/nbd1
brw-rw---- 1 root disk 43, 640 2008-03-25 11:11 /dev/nbd10
brw-rw---- 1 root disk 43, 704 2008-03-25 11:11 /dev/nbd11
brw-rw---- 1 root disk 43, 768 2008-03-25 11:11 /dev/nbd12
brw-rw---- 1 root disk 43, 832 2008-03-25 11:11 /dev/nbd13
brw-rw---- 1 root disk 43, 896 2008-03-25 11:11 /dev/nbd14
brw-rw---- 1 root disk 43, 960 2008-03-25 11:11 /dev/nbd15
brw-rw---- 1 root disk 43, 128 2008-03-25 11:11 /dev/nbd2
brw-rw---- 1 root disk 43, 192 2008-03-25 11:11 /dev/nbd3
brw-rw---- 1 root disk 43, 256 2008-03-25 11:11 /dev/nbd4
brw-rw---- 1 root disk 43, 320 2008-03-25 11:11 /dev/nbd5
brw-rw---- 1 root disk 43, 384 2008-03-25 11:11 /dev/nbd6
brw-rw---- 1 root disk 43, 448 2008-03-25 11:11 /dev/nbd7
brw-rw---- 1 root disk 43, 512 2008-03-25 11:11 /dev/nbd8
brw-rw---- 1 root disk 43, 576 2008-03-25 11:11 /dev/nbd9
# nbd-client localhost 1234 /dev/nbd0
Negotiation: ..size = 80418240KB
bs=1024, sz=80418240
-------NOTE, RFC: partition table is not automatically read.
The driver sets bdev->bd_invalidated to 1 to force the read of the partition
table of the device, but this is done only on an open of the device.
So we have to do a "touch /dev/nbdX" or something like that.
It can't be done from the nbd-client or nbd driver because at this
level we can't ask to read the partition table and to serve the request
at the same time (-> deadlock)
If someone has a better idea, I'm open to any suggestion.
-------NOTE, RFC
# fdisk -l /dev/nbd0
Disk /dev/nbd0: 82.3 GB, 82348277760 bytes
255 heads, 63 sectors/track, 10011 cylinders
Units = cylinders of 16065 * 512 = 8225280
bytes
Device Boot Start End Blocks Id System
/dev/nbd0p1 * 1 9965 80043831 83 Linux
/dev/nbd0p2 9966 10011 369495 5 Extended
/dev/nbd0p5 9966 10011 369463+ 82 Linux swap / Solaris
# ls -l /dev/nbd0*
brw-rw---- 1 root disk 43, 0 2008-03-25 11:16 /dev/nbd0
brw-rw---- 1 root disk 43, 1 2008-03-25 11:16 /dev/nbd0p1
brw-rw---- 1 root disk 43, 2 2008-03-25 11:16 /dev/nbd0p2
brw-rw---- 1 root disk 43, 5 2008-03-25 11:16 /dev/nbd0p5
# mount /dev/nbd0p1 /mnt
# ls /mnt
bin dev initrd lost+found opt sbin sys var
boot etc initrd.img media proc selinux tmp vmlinuz
cdrom home lib mnt root srv usr
# umount /mnt
# nbd-client -d /dev/nbd0
# ls -l /dev/nbd0*
brw-rw---- 1 root disk 43, 0 2008-03-25 11:16 /dev/nbd0
-------NOTE
On "nbd-client -d", we can do an iocl(BLKRRPART) to update partition table:
as the size of the device is 0, we don't have to serve the partition manager
request (-> no deadlock).
-------NOTE
